Two markets are correlated when the exact same result decides both of them. Here is a simple example:
The Moneyline is a bet on which team wins the match, nothing else. The Asian Handicap is a bet on which team wins once you add or subtract a head start (the “handicap”). If you back the same team on both, the same final score decides whether you win or lose both bets.
But sharing an outcome is not the same as sharing a price. Each market has its own betting capacity, and its own history of how its price has moved. Because of that, a bookmaker adjusts their odds independently, even though both are tied to the same result. That gap is really what the original question was about.
Below, we will walk through two examples with made up but realistic numbers.
The Moneyline is usually the simplest market on a match, and it also gets the most betting volume. That combination means it tends to react to new information the fastest.
The Handicap market has one more moving part than the Moneyline does. It has a price, just like the Moneyline, but it also has the handicap number itself (like -0.5 or +1). When new information comes in, a bookmaker might adjust the Handicap’s price a little first, and only change the handicap if the gap is too big to ignore.
For a short period of time, maybe just a few minutes, the “true” probability given by the Moneyline can be a ahead of what the Handicap market is showing. This is not a mistake in either market, it just means that each market is updating at a slightly different speed.

Every betting price has a “vig” built into it. The vig is the bookmaker’s margin, is the small profit that they take on all odds that makes the odds slightly worse than the true/fair odds would be.
“De-vigging” a price means doing the math to remove that margin, so you can see the real view of how likely each outcome is.
Once you de-vig both markets above, the odds should agree perfectly. In our example there is approximately a 55% chance Portugal win , a 25% chance of a draw, and a 20% chance Denmark win.

Now imagine we fast forward to 90 minutes before kickoff. Denmark’s starting centre-back (their best defender) gets injured. That is a piece of news that should make Portugal more likely to win.
Because the Moneyline is usually the most-watched, highest-volume market on a match, money and information hits there first. Portugal’s price shortens to 1.55, the Draw moves to 4.10, and Denmark odds increase up to 6.00. De-vig the new prices and the market’s updated view is roughly Portugal 61%, Draw 23%, Denmark 16%.
The Asian Handicap, meanwhile, has not moved at all yet. It is still sitting at exactly the same prices as two hours earlier, Portugal 1.77 and Denmark 2.17, still implying just a 55% chance that Portugal wins.
For a window of maybe ten or fifteen minutes, you have two markets tied to the exact same match telling you two different probabilities. The Moneyline says 61%. The Handicap still says 55%.
That six percentage gap is the lag one of our Discord users was describing. It is not a mistake or a glitch . It is simply one market updating to the news before the other.
The second question is about a different pair of markets, but it comes down to the same logic.
In sports where a match can end in a draw, the main match result market offers three possible outcomes: Home win, Draw, or Away win (3-way market).
Markets like the Asian Handicap or Over/Under sit underneath that headline market, and they work differently. They only offer two possible outcomes, which is why they are called “2-way markets“. A 2-way market does not have a separate option for a draw. Instead, it transfers the chance of a draw into its price and its line.
Because a 3-way market and a 2-way market split up the same chances into a different number of possible outcomes, they don’t have to move by the same amount when new information comes in.
If something changes how likely the draw is, that shows up immediately in the 3-way price. But in a 2-way market, that same change can only show up indirectly, through the line, the price, or both.

Now compare that to “Draw No Bet.” Draw No Bet is a 2-way market. If the match ends in a draw, your stake is simply refunded. It is really an Asian Handicap set at exactly zero. Because it has no draw option, it has to do something with that 29% chance of a draw. It splits that probability between the two teams, in proportion to how likely each team already was to win. Japan’s share works out to 43 divided by (43 plus 28), which is about 61%. Australia’s share is 28 divided by (43 plus 28), which is about 39%.
Add the bookmaker’s margin back into those numbers and you get a Draw No Bet price of roughly Japan 1.60 and Australia 2.45.
Now look at the two full sets of prices side by side. The 3-way market shows 2.20, 3.30, 3.40. The Draw No Bet market shows 1.60, 2.45. On the surface these look nothing alike. But they encode exactly the same view of the match. The 3-way market spent one whole outcome (the draw) on its own separate price. The 2-way market took that same information and folded it into just two adjusted numbers instead. Neither market is wrong or ahead of the other. They are simply two different ways of reacting to the exact same information, which is exactly the gap the second Discord question was pointing at.
So why does any of this actually matter, beyond understanding how the markets works?
In the Portugal example. For those ten or fifteen minutes, the Moneyline was already saying 61%, while the Handicap was still saying 55%. That gap is a preview. It is the faster market telling you, ahead of time, where the slower market’s price is about to go.
Acting on that means betting the side of the market that has not caught up yet, before it does. In our example, that means taking Portugal at 1.77 on the Handicap, while the fair price (based on what the Moneyline already knows) is closer to 1.63.
Fifteen minutes later, once the Handicap market catches up and re-prices Portugal down to somewhere near 1.63, that edge disappears.

What are correlated markets in betting? Markets whose outcomes depend on the same result.
Why do Handicap and Moneyline lines move at different speeds? Each market has its own liquidity and volume, and adjusting a handicap line is a bigger change than adjusting a price.
Is a lag between correlated markets a sign of a mispriced bet? Not necessarily, it’s often just two markets updating on different schedules.
Why is match-result a 3-way market but Handicap a 2-way market? Because a draw is a possible outcome in many sports. The 3-way market prices it directly, 2-way markets like Handicap fold that probability into the line instead of offering a draw price.
Should a 3-way market and the 2-way markets below it always move together? They’re related, not identical, they split the same event probability into a different structure, so a move in one doesn’t mean an equal move in the other.
